Former Soviet tennis player Olga Morozova told that for the Russian Karena Khachanova winning the ATP 250 tournament in Qatar is a good start to the season.
On Saturday, Khachanov won the ATP tournament in Doha. In the final match, the Russian beat the 18-year-old Czech tennis player in straight sets. Jakub Menchik occupying 116th place in the world rankings.
— I would like to congratulate Karen Khachanov. He is emotional and plays spectacular tennis. His great victories at the Grand Slam and Masters tournaments are before my eyes. Karen was in the top ten and had a great match, but then injuries intervened. Now Khachanov is getting in shape and playing better and better with each match.
The victory in Doha is a good start to the season, but two most important spring tournaments await us: Indian Wells and Miami. A large number of points are up for grabs there, I hope Khachanov will be lucky with the net there and show his best results. I would like him to succeed in everything Karen has planned this year,” Morozova told .
This is the first tournament since September 2023 that Khachanov has managed to win – he then won the competition in Zhuhai, China. The Russian currently occupies 17th place in the ATP rankings.
